CDER's Drug-Drug Interaction Database Will Be Functional By 2000
Executive Summary
CDER's drug-drug interaction scientific database will be functional two years ahead of schedule, FDA's fiscal 1999 revision to the Prescription Drug User Fee Act Information Management Plan indicates.
